Call for Unpublished Papers on Customer Reactions to AI agents
We are looking for any unpublished studies or working papers you might have for a meta-analysis of the artificial intelligence (AI) literature.
We warmly invite submissions that focus on the effect of AI (vs. human or other) agents on consumer responses in marketing. Specifically, we seek studies or unpublished studies that:
- manipulate the type of agent (human vs. AI, including GenAI, algorithms, etc.);
- analyze the effects on consumer intentions, attitudes and behaviors (For example, purchase intentions, satisfaction with interactions with the agent, attitudes towards the brand, trust in the agent, willingness to pay).
Submission Guidelines
If you would like to share your unpublished manuscripts with us, please:
- ensure that the documents provide effect sizes or the necessary statistics to calculate them (sample size, mean, standard deviations, correlation coefficients, etc.); and
- attach any study materials, i.e. any supplementary materials that contain information on what is manipulated in your studies, and how it is manipulated, as well as your measures.
Please submit the document(s) to metaanalysisai@gmail.com in either .doc, .pdf, or .ppt format by Friday July 15th GMT.
